EA Engineering, Science, and Technology, Inc., PBC. is Hiring an Environmental Scientist or Biologist Near Honolulu, HI

Date Posted: 6/14/24 Job Description:
We have an excellent opportunity for an Environmental Scientist or Biologist in our Honolulu, HI office.
What You Will DoThe Environmental Scientist or Biologist will assist in a wide range of natural resources projects.
Specific Responsibilities Include
  • Assist senior staff with preparing project documents (work plans, proposals, reports, etc.), and business development.
  • Plan, coordinate, and lead field efforts.
  • Collect and evaluate data and reporting.
  • Field studies to support flora and fauna surveys.
  • Habitat assessments and management.
  • Threatened and endangered species surveys.
  • Ecological monitoring.
  • Wetland and aquatic resources characterizations and assessments.
  • Support permitting, compliance, and remedial investigation projects.
Note: Possible travel to neighbor islands and other locations throughout the United States.
What We ProvideEA prides itself on servant leadership, career development for staff in all areas, and maintaining work-life balance including flexible schedules. We have a tremendous base of positive client relationships. This has resulted in a stable backlog of projects and opportunities for growth. We also offer a fantastic benefits package!
What You Will Need
  • Bachelor’s degree in biology, ecology, environmental science, or related field.
  • 2-5 years of experience in environmental consulting or similar setting.
  • Experience in work plan preparation, permit applications, and technical report writing.
  • Willingness to conduct field work in varying field conditions (hot, humid, stormy, etc.)
  • Intermediate knowledge of GIS software (ArcGIS) and modeling applications preferred.
  • Experience in wildlife and plant identification and an understanding of ecological resources management is a plus.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ft applications and Adobe Acrobat.
  • Attention to detail.
  • Ability to acquire access to military installations and have a valid driver’s license.
  • Comfortability working on office-based tasks and field activities.
  • Current OSHA HAZWOPER, Emergency Response HAZWOPER, and First Aid/CPR certifications preferred.
  • An understanding of environmental science within the Pacific region and/or coastal settings.
  • Willingness to travel locally and out of state.

About EA Engineering, Science, and Technology, Inc., PBC.

EA is a 100%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P)-owned public benefit corporation that provides environmental, compliance, natural resources, and infrastructure engineering and management solutions to a wide range of public and private sector clients. Headquartered in Hunt Valley, Maryland, EA employs more than 500 professionals through a network of 25 commercial offices across the continental United States, as well as Alaska, Hawaii, and Guam.
